Professor - Social Work teaches courses in the discipline area of social work. Develops and designs curriculum plans to foster student learning, stimulate class discussions, and ensures student engagement. Being a Professor - Social Work provides tutoring and academic counseling to students, maintains classes related records, and assesses student coursework. Collaborates and supports colleagues regarding research interests and co-curricular activities. Additionally, Professor - Social Work typically reports to a department head. Requires a PhD or terminal degree appropriate to the field. Has considerable experience and is qualified to teach at undergraduate and graduate levels and initiates research and case studies in field of interest and may publish findings in trade journals or textbooks. Provides intellectual leadership and has made significant contributions to the field. May offer independent study opportunities and mentoring to students. Typically this individual is a leader in the field and has been published.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

    Job Duties:

    The Clinical Care Team will take referrals from primary care providers and will work with the primary care team to accomplish the following tasks:

    Social support navigation for social determinants of health (SDOH) such as food insecurity, housing insecurity, etc.

    o Compile and maintain a resource list for SDOH resources including eligibility criteria, referral process, and contact information

    o Collaborate with primary care nurse and providers

    o Provide in-person or remote social needs screening/assessment with primary care patients referred by nurse or provider

    o Coordinate or make aware of social services resources, i.e., housing, clothing, food, mental health services, etc.

    o Collaborate with other social workers to identify patient and community resources

    · Conduct case management activities

    o Work with hospitals for discharge planning, follow-up and education

    o Assist with obtaining patient records from hospitals

    o Assist in securing needed medical equipment through community partners

    o Conduct follow-up on care plans

    o Identify patients lost to follow-up or overdue for care and assist them in returning to care

    · May assist with specialty referral navigation

    o Schedule, coordinate, and track non-BCS specialist and imaging referrals

    o Assist with obtaining patient records from specialists and imaging centers

    o Compile and maintain resource list for specialty referrals including eligibility criteria, referral process, cost and contact information

    · Assist patients to locate and access low-cost prescription options such as patient assistance programs, discount retailers, etc.

    o May assist with patient assistance program applications and serve as a patient-provider liaison with the drug companies

    o Assist patient with applications for programs such as CoverRx and RxOutreach

    · May help with other regional primary care-based initiatives with a social work component

    · Documents in patient’s record, updates consults, and tags provider and/or clinical staff as necessary

    · Provide patient education or find appropriate education resources

Clarksville is the county seat of Montgomery County, Tennessee, United States. It is the fifth-largest city in the state behind Nashville, Memphis, Knoxville, and Chattanooga. The city had a population of 132,929 at the 2010 census, and an estimated population of 153,205 in 2017. It is the principal central city of the Clarksville, TN–KY metropolitan statistical area, which consists of Montgomery and Stewart Counties in Tennessee, and Christian and Trigg Counties in Kentucky.
